Andrew Wiggins Heads To Kansas (News)



The Number 1 Player in the 2013 Class in High School Hoops shocked many today. Toronto native Andrew Wiggins from Huntington Prep (WV) made his collegiate choice to attend Kansas University. The 6'7 Wiggins was highly recruited & was considering Florida State, North Carolina, Kansas & Kentucky as his final four choices. Wiggins scored 23.4 points and grabbed 11.2 rebounds per game this season, passed up a chance to be part of what's being hailed as the greatest recruiting class since the Fab Five, Kentucky's. Instead of being one star among two handfuls, he'll be the guy at Kansas. "Obviously, everyone in Jayhawk-land is overwhelmed and excited today," Kansas coach Bill Self said in a statement. "This was a pleasant surprise because we never had an idea which way he was leading. Andrew did this the exact way he said he was going to. He played his cards very close to his vest as did his mother and father. I knew we were one of four. The competition was very stiff and we were fortunate that we were able to ink him today. He's a tremendous talent and a terrific kid. Probably an even better kid than he is a talent. We think he has a chance to be about as good a prospect as we've ever had." "He brings athleticism, length, scoring ability and he's also an assassin, an alpha dog and we definitely need that when you have a whole bunch of young kids," Self said. "I think he's going to be not just a good player, but have the chance to be a great one. I know the people that support our program are going to be pleasantly surprised when they see him run and play the very first time he gets the opportunity."

Kansas will return Sophomores Perry Ellis and Jamari Traylor and junior guard Naadir Tharpe are essentially the Jayhawks' only significant returnees, and the trio combined for just 13.4 points a game last year. Wiggins will join two other five-star recruits in center Joel Embiid and wing Wayne Selden and two top-50 prospects, guard Conner Frankamp and forward Brannen Greene could make the Jayhawks a strong contender for a 10th consecutive Big 12 regular-season title.
